General Spiroffite Information

Help on Chemical  Formula: Chemical Formula:

(Mn,Zn)2Te3O8

Help on Composition: Composition:

Molecular Weight = 625.90 gm

Manganese 13.17 % Mn 17.00 % MnO

Zinc 5.22 % Zn 6.50 % ZnO

Tellurium 61.16 % Te 76.50 % TeO2

Oxygen 20.45 % O

______ ______

100.00 % 100.00 % = TOTAL OXIDE

Help on Empirical Formula: Empirical Formula:

Mn2+1.5Zn0.5Te3O8

Help on Environment: Environment:

Secondary mineral found in oxidized, telluride-bearing rocks.

Help on IMA Status: IMA Status:

Approved IMA 1962

Help on Locality: Locality:

Moctezuma mine ("La Bambolla"), Moctezuma, Sonora, Mexico. Link to MinDat.org Location Data.

Help on Name Origin: Name Origin:

Named for Kiril Spiroff (1901-1981), Bulgarian-American economic geologist, Michigan College of Mining and Technology.

Spiroffite Crystallography

Help on Axial Ratios: Axial Ratios:

a:b:c =2.4163:1:2.2527

Help on Cell Dimensions: Cell Dimensions:

a = 13, b = 5.38, c = 12.12, Z = 4; beta = 98° V = 839.42 Den(Calc)= 4.95

Help on Crystal System: Crystal System:

Monoclinic - PrismaticH-M Symbol (2/m) Space Group: C 2/c

Help on X Ray Diffraction: X Ray Diffraction:

By Intensity(I/Io): 3(1), 4.98(1), 4.06(0.8),

Physical Properties of Spiroffite

Help on Cleavage: Cleavage:

{???} Distinct, {???} Distinct

Help on Color: Color:

Red, Purple.

Help on Density: Density:

5.01

Help on Fracture: Fracture:

Conchoidal - Fractures developed in brittle materials characterized by smoothly curving surfaces, (e.g. quartz).

Help on Habit: Habit:

Comb - Drusy layers deposited on top of each other to produce a toothed structure (e.g. amethyst)

Help on Habit: Habit:

Massive - Uniformly indistinguishable crystals forming large masses.

Help on Hardness: Hardness:

3.5 - Copper Penny

Help on Luminescence: Luminescence:

Non-fluorescent.

Help on Luster: Luster:

Adamantine

Help on Streak: Streak:

brown red

Optical Properties of Spiroffite

Help on Gladstone-Dale: Gladstone-Dale:

CI meas= 0.003 (Superior) - where the CI = (1-KPDmeas/KC)
CI calc= -0.009 (Superior) - where the CI = (1-KPDcalc/KC)
KPDcalc= 0.1993,KPDmeas= 0.1969,KC= 0.1975
Ncalc = 1.98 - 1.99

Help on Optical Data: Optical Data:

Biaxial (+), a=1.85, b=1.91, g=2.2, bire=0.3500, 2V(Calc)=56, 2V(Meas)=55.
